6. For a 3.5-inch hard drive, remove the screws that secure the hard drive to the hard-drive bracket. Slide the hard drive from the hard-drive bracket. Installing the Hard Drive 1. For a 3.5-inch hard drive, slide the hard drive into the hard-drive bracket. Tighten the screws that secure the hard drive to the hard-drive bracket. 2. For a 2.5-inch hard drive, tighten the screws that secure the hard-drive case to the hard drive. Slide the hard drive into the hard-drive bracket. Tighten the screws that secure the hard drive to the hard-drive bracket. 3. Align and place the hard-drive bracket on the computer. Tighten the screw that secures the hard-drive bracket to the system board. 4. Connect the hard drive cables to the hard drive. Thread the cables into the notches on the hard-drive bracket. 5. Install: a) VESA mount bracket b) back cover c) VESA stand 6. Follow the procedures in After Working Inside Your Computer. Removing the Intrusion Switch 1.
